How to Make AI Music: An Introduction to Creative Machine Learning
In the world of music production, innovation is the name of the game. From groundbreaking techniques to cutting-edge technologies, musicians and producers are constantly seeking new ways to push the boundaries of what is possible in their craft. One such innovation that has recently garnered a lot of attention is the use of artificial intelligence (AI) to generate music and help in the creative process.
AI music, also known as generative music, is the process of using machine learning algorithms to compose, produce, and even perform music. This technology has the potential to revolutionize the way we create and experience music, but it also raises important questions about the role of AI in art and creativity. In this article, we will explore the basics of creating AI music and discuss some of the potential benefits and challenges of this emerging field.
Getting Started with AI Music
The first step in making AI music is to understand the basics of machine learning and how it can be used to generate musical compositions. Machine learning is a subfield of artificial intelligence that focuses on the development of algorithms that can learn from and make predictions or decisions based on data. In the context of music, this means using algorithms that are trained on large datasets of musical compositions to generate new pieces of music that are stylistically similar to the ones they were trained on.
There are several different approaches to AI music generation, but one of the most popular methods is using recurrent neural networks (RNNs) and deep learning. RNNs are a type of neural network that is well-suited for processing sequential data, such as time-series data or sequences of musical notes. By training an RNN on a dataset of musical compositions, it is possible to create a model that can generate new musical sequences based on the patterns it has learned from the training data.
In addition to RNNs, there are also other machine learning techniques, such as generative adversarial networks (GANs) and variational autoencoders (VAEs), that can be used to create AI music. These techniques work by learning the underlying structure of a dataset of music and generating new compositions based on this learned structure.
Benefits of AI Music
The use of AI in music production offers several potential benefits for musicians and producers. One of the most significant advantages is the ability to quickly generate large amounts of musical material. AI algorithms can produce new compositions at a much faster rate than human composers, allowing musicians to explore a wider range of ideas and create more diverse and original music.
Another benefit of AI music is the potential for collaboration between humans and machines. By using AI algorithms to generate musical ideas, musicians can harness the creative power of machine learning to inspire and inform their own artistic process. This can lead to new and unexpected musical possibilities that would not have been possible through traditional means.
Challenges of AI Music
While AI music has the potential to revolutionize music production, it also raises important questions and challenges. One of the primary concerns is the impact of AI on human creativity and artistic expression. Some musicians worry that the use of AI in music production could lead to a homogenization of musical styles and a loss of the human touch in music.
Another challenge is the ethical and legal implications of using AI-generated music. As AI algorithms become more advanced, it is possible that they could create compositions that resemble existing copyrighted works, raising questions about intellectual property rights and plagiarism. Additionally, there are concerns about the potential for AI-generated music to be used for deceptive or manipulative purposes, such as creating fake music or imitating the style of a particular artist without their consent.
Conclusion
The use of AI in music production is an exciting and rapidly evolving field that has the potential to transform the way we create and experience music. By harnessing the power of machine learning, musicians and producers can explore new creative possibilities and push the boundaries of what is possible in music.
As AI music continues to develop, it will be important for musicians, producers, and technologists to consider the ethical and artistic implications of this technology. By engaging in open and thoughtful dialogue about the role of AI in music, we can ensure that this technology is used responsibly and in a way that enhances, rather than diminishes, the creative potential of music.